Refactor of the Ormlet legacy mapper ships in this cut. Old lazy-load hooks are gone; use the explicit fetch API. Migrations are idempotent and safe to rerun. Do not re-enable the compat shim — it masks N+1 regressions. Smoke-test the Ledgerfield tenant before sign-off. Future maintainers: the canonical schema snapshot lives next to the migration folder. Pin any rollback to the build identified by the token below.

session token of bawep-yadup = htk21_528abd376e3c5a4ec24a1

## Releases — ProfileMesh Shard Rollout

Shard migrations ship as signed bundles. One shard group per release window. Order: drain, snapshot, reshard, verify counts, cut over. Rollback is snapshot restore only; never reshard backward. The Quillbrook cluster goes last — it holds the heaviest tenants. Release manager signs the bundle and the shard map together; mismatched signatures abort the cutover automatically. Tag the release, push to the registry, then sign. All shard bundles for this cycle are signed with the following key:

rollout seal: bky4_x7Gc

// Contrast audit client setup — Project Glimmerline.
// This client submits rendered component screenshots to the internal
// HueGate service, which scores foreground/background pairs against
// our WCAG-equivalent thresholds. Keep the timeout at 30s; large
// theme matrices are slow. Do not batch more than 40 swatches per
// call or HueGate truncates silently. Authentication uses the key
// that follows directly beneath this comment.

API key for fadup-tadug: vxb23-eAKAplAIXbksJHWEnzMeawU

Break-glass access for Spoolhaven, the printer-spooler microservice at Merridock Labs, is limited to declared incidents. Access bypasses the normal approval chain and is fully logged for audit. To initiate, open the emergency console and select Spoolhaven from the service list. The console will then request the recovery passphrase recorded below.

vault phrase of bagaf-kajeg = jorath-feniel-briir-siliel-ralix